One question; if you build an app via these no-code platforms, can you ever export it and "disconnect it" from the SAAS providers you covered so you can ditch the membership and proceed with a developer? Or is that how they keep you locked in?
Flutterflow and Draftbit allow you to export 100% of the code to host it on your own. It's pretty awesome. No platform lock-in there. Other platforms don't let you export code though.

This is probably a dumb question, but the only really dumb question is the one not asked. If make an app and have it uploaded to Apple or Google stores, does that mean I have to keep paying these sites to keep it in the store? How does that work?
Hey! Great question.
If you use their hosting infrastructure, then yes, you have to keep paying.
Flutterflow and Draftbit however both allow you to export the code to host it elsewhere if you wish to do so.
@@glebkrasmedia Yeah, but therein lies the gotcha. If you move it somewhere else, you have to dig into the code to change the source url location. That kind of change would require you to either do it before sending it to mobile stores or having to resubmit to the mobile stores. Then there is the fact of trying to find this url location in a million lines of code which most likely leaves you with having to hire a developer and having to charge more for the app to pay for it. What if the developer wants to be paid before the app launches? To top it off, the one pricing structure kinda goes by the wayside with monthly costs.
This kinda ruins my app idea. It is a simple app that solves a simple problem. Thus, I was going to charge a buck for it and that is all. Highly unlikely anyone wants to pay a monthly fee for it. Sad! Thank you for answering!
